Abstract

The present invention relates to a book scanning copyright management system and method, and more particularly, to a system and method for managing copyright of a book scan book, more precisely supporting accurate collection of a scanned book and log recording of a scanning act so as to facilitate the collection and distribution of compensation money To a book scan copyright management system and method for preventing a scanned book from being uploaded to a shared server such as a web hard in a digital form. The present invention provides a registration code for authorizing legitimacy for each scanning action of the business apparatus to a book that is permitted to be scanned specified by a copyright holder to be inserted into e-book contents created through scanning of the book , It is possible to easily support the collection and distribution of the compensation money in addition to the development of the correct compensation amount according to the registration code issuance, and at the same time, the responsible contents can be clarified clearly based on the registration code issued to the e-book contents when the unauthorized distribution of the e-book contents So that the unauthorized distribution of the e-book contents corresponding to the book is prevented in advance.

2. Description of the Related Art In recent years, there has been an increasing demand for an electronic book that is scanned from a general book to be stored in a user terminal and conveniently browsed.

However, these e-books can be copied more easily than general books due to their characteristics, and it is possible to distribute them through a communication network at the same time.

However, since it is not possible to prevent the scanning act of such a book, the author or publisher of the current book collaborates with the copyright trust organization to set the scope and permission range of the scanned document, and to allow the book scanning service provider to scan And a method of receiving a certain amount of compensation from the book scanning service provider every time the electronic book is reproduced for distribution of the electronic book is being sought.

However, there is a limit in checking whether the scan operation is normally performed within the allowable range, and it is difficult to form an accurate compensation, and thus, it still shows a distrust of the conventional scan permission.

In addition, since there is no guarantee that a user who has distributed an e-book does not transmit to an OSP (Online Service Provider) server such as a web hard, the copyright holder can pay the compensation according to the scanning permission, Of the total population.

FIG. 1 is a configuration view of a book scan copyright management system according to an embodiment of the present invention. As shown in FIG. 1, the book scan book copyright management system is a system for managing copyright management information of a book, which is scanned by a copyright holder, And an external server 300 operated by an organization providing book information on an ISBN (International Standard Book Number) information, a book title, a publisher, an author, and a date of publication for a book such as the National Central Library A book scan book management server 100 for collecting book information corresponding to the book through a communication network and matching and storing minutia information about the minutiae in the DB 101, The electronic book contents corresponding to the book are generated and transmitted to the user device 10 of the user (10) inserts a registration code for permitting a scanning operation on the book into the electronic book content (20), and the user device (10) receiving the electronic book content storing the issued registration code And a book scan log management server 200 for verifying the validity of the e-book contents through the authentication of the management server 100 and the registration code.

The user apparatus 10 and the business entity apparatus 20 may include a tablet PC having a communication function, an output function, and various interface functions, A portable terminal, a mobile terminal, a personal digital assistant (PDA), a portable multimedia player (PMP) terminal, a personal computer ), A wearable personal station (WPS), and the like. Further, the business entity apparatus 20 may be constituted by a server.

At present, college textbooks are copied in chapters, allowing copyright holders to circulate them, which is possible because they receive a certain amount of copying money per student from the university. Collection of reparations shall be made only by the Korea Reproduction and Transfer Association (hereinafter referred to as the "Futenbu") collectively and distributed to the universities registered in the FUJI.

In order to collect and distribute the reimbursement to the scanned books through the paper books and comic book scanners including the college textbooks, accurate identification of the scanned books, log records of the scanning activities, To be uploaded to the same shared server 400 is required.

Accordingly, the book scan book management server 100 according to the present invention is able to read the book data from the scan data obtained through the scan of the book for accurate identification of the book permitted to be scanned by the copyright holder such as an organization such as a post- It is possible to clearly identify the book to be scanned by the business entity device 20 based on the minutia information generated through minutiae extraction and the matching book information, And when it is uploaded, it is easily detected to prevent unauthorized distribution of e-book contents.

In addition, the book scan log management server 200 according to the present invention transmits a registration code for recognizing legitimacy for each scan action of the business entity device 20 to the book, which is permitted to be scanned by the copyright holder, Book contents generated through the scanning of the book so that it is possible to easily support the collection and distribution of the rewards together with the development of an accurate reward for issuing the registration code, It is possible to unambiguously disclose the responsible content on the basis of the registration code issued to the e-book content, so that the unauthorized distribution of the e-book contents corresponding to the book can be prevented in advance.

The detailed configuration of the book scan book copyright management system according to the emb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to FIG.

As shown in FIG. 2, the book scan book management server 100 can extract minutia points from scan data obtained by scanning the book, which is allowed to be scanned by the copyright holder, through the scanner 102, and generate minutia information.

In this case, the scan data may be in the form of an image. In addition, the book scanning server 100 may scan the published book and convert the text file obtained by the character recognition processing into HTML format, Data may be generated. In addition, the book scan book management server 100 may receive the scan data directly in HTML form or image form from an author or a publisher in addition to the scanner 102.

The book scan book management server 100 also transmits the ISBN information acquired from the copyright holder to the external server 300 operated by an institution such as the national central library and receives the ISBN information from the external server 300 Copyright information including a title, a publisher, an author, a publication date, and book information including the ISBN information related to the book may be received, and the book information may be matched with the minutia information and stored in the DB 101.

On the other hand, the business entity apparatus 20 of the provider who is requested to produce the e-book contents through the scan of the book from the user generates scan data for the book through the scanner 21, 100) may extract feature points from the scan data using API (Application Program Interface) for extracting the feature points, and generate minutia information. The request information including the minutia information is stored in the book scan book management server (100) via a communication network.

At this time, the scan data generated by the business entity apparatus may also be configured in HTML or image format.

In other words, the business entity apparatus 20 extracts minutiae from the book using the same algorithm as the algorithm used by the book scan book management server 100 for extracting minutiae points from the book scan book management server 100, (100).

Accordingly, the book scan book management server 100 compares minutia information included in the request information received from the business entity apparatus 20 with the DB 101, and stores the minutia information included in the request information in the DB 101 It is possible to extract the book information matched with the minutia information having the same or similar degree as the set minutia information or the minutia information having the similarity value equal to or higher than a preset reference value and transmit the extracted book information to the business entity apparatus 20 through the communication network.

At this time, when the bookmark scan server 100 has the minutia information matching the minutia information included in the request information in the DB 101 but there is no book information matched with the minutia information, the book scanner 20 ) May request the ISBN information of the book corresponding to the request information.

The book scan book management server 100 receives the ISBN information corresponding to the request information from the business entity apparatus 20 and transmits the ISBN information to the external server 300, And transmits the book information retrieved by the ISBN information corresponding to the information to the business entity apparatus 20.

Meanwhile, the business entity apparatus 20 can receive the book information and transmit it to the book scan log management server 200 via the communication network together with the previously stored business information.

Accordingly, the book scan log management server 200 issues a registration code to the business entity device 20 based on the book information and business entity information received from the business entity device 20, and issues the registration code To authenticate legitimate scanning actions.

In addition, the book scan log management server 200 may generate and store log information corresponding to the registration code issued each time the registration code is issued.

Accordingly, the book scan log management server 200 determines the number of scans for the book based on the log information, and informs the business entity 20 of the amount of compensation generated according to the scanning action on the book The log information may be used as the data for collecting the collected data or the log information may be transmitted to the server operating in the backup complex to support the compensation distribution according to the scanning behavior of the book.

On the other hand, the business entity apparatus 20 generates e-book contents for the book, inserts the registration code, book information, and business entity information into the e-book contents and transmits the e-book contents to the user device 10 It can be transmitted through a communication network.

At this time, the business entity apparatus may generate the electronic book contents in EPUB (electronic publication) or PDF format.

Accordingly, the viewer unit 11 installed in the user apparatus 10 receiving the e-book contents can view the e-book contents through the output unit of the user apparatus 10.

At this time, the business entity apparatus 20 may encrypt the e-book content according to a predetermined encryption algorithm and transmit it to the user device 10. The viewer section 11 of the user device 10 decrypts the encrypted e- And may be displayed on the output unit of the user device 10. At this time, DRM (Digital Rights Management) can be applied as an example of a content protection method in addition to encryption.

Meanwhile, the viewer unit 11 may extract the registration code from the electronic book contents including the registration code, the book information, and the provider information, and may transmit the registration code to the book scan log management server 200, The server 200 can verify the validity of the e-book contents by comparing the registration code with previously stored log information.

Therefore, if the log information corresponding to the registration code exists, the book scan log management server 200 can determine the valid e-book content and provide the verification result to the user device 10.

At this time, the book scan log management server 200 may be a server operating in the combined scan, and may store scan permission information including a reward reference for each book, a scan allowance range, a scan allowance period, , And can determine whether to issue the registration code based on the scan permission information.

In addition, the book scan log management server 200 determines a reward amount based on the log information collected for the book according to the reward payment standard included in the scan permission information, and transmits the reward collection amount to the vendor device 20 The user can perform the collection of the compensation according to the number of scans of the book from the business entity apparatus 20 and distribute the compensation collected from the business entity apparatus 20 at a preset ratio according to the compensation standard, It is possible to calculate and store the amount information on the distribution amount of the money.

Accordingly, the book scan log management server 200 can generate the basis data for calculating the correct reward according to the scan action, and thereby can help the reward collection and distribution to be accurately performed.

Meanwhile, when the user apparatus 10 receiving the e-book contents from the business entity apparatus 20 through a scan request for the book illegally uploads the e-book contents to the share server 400, Thereby preventing unauthorized sharing of the e-book contents. This will be described in detail based on the configuration of FIG.

3, when the user apparatus 10 receiving the e-book contents uploads the e-book contents to a shared server 400 sharing various contents, the sharing server 400 transmits the e- Extracts the minutiae from the uploaded e-book contents using the API for minutia extraction provided by the book management server 100, generates minutia information about the extracted minutiae and transmits the minutia information to the book scan book management server 100 It can be transmitted through a communication network.

The book scan book management server 100 may compare the minutia information received from the shared server 400 with the DB 101 and extract copyright information from the book information matched with the matching minutia information.

The book scan server 100 may transmit the copyright information to the sharing server 400 and the shared server 400 may transmit the copyright information to the electronic book It is possible to set the copyright for the book content and to block the sharing of the e-book content in which the copyright is set according to the preset policy information, or to convert the e-book content into a fee for sharing.

At this time, the sharing server 400 may provide the copyright owner with the compensation generated by sharing the e-book contents set to be paid, so that the sharing can be legitimately performed.

Accordingly, even when illegal sharing of e-book contents generated by a legitimate scanning operation occurs, the present invention can clearly identify e-book contents uploaded through minutia comparison and prevent unauthorized distribution.

FIG. 4 is a block diagram illustrating a detailed configuration of a book scan book management server 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ention. As shown in FIG. 4, a feature point extracting unit 110, a book managing unit 120, . ≪ / RTI >

First, the minutia matching point extracting unit 110 extracts minutiae points from the scan data obtained by scanning the book in conjunction with the scanner 102 connected to the book scan managing server 100 using a predetermined API, Can be generated.

In addition, the book management unit 120 transmits ISBN information about the book to the external server 300, receives book information corresponding to the ISBN information from the external server 300, The feature point information and the book information may be matched and stored in the DB 101.

The comparison unit 130 receives request information including minutia information generated through minutia extraction from the scan data obtained by scanning the book from the business entity apparatus 20, (101), extracts book information matching the minutia information included in the request information or matching minutia information having a similarity value equal to or greater than a preset reference value from the DB (101), and transmits the extracted book information to the business entity device .

Also, the comparison unit 130 may receive minutia information obtained from the e-book content from the shared server 400 and compare the minutia information with the DB 101 to acquire minutia information obtained from the e-book content, The book information matching or matching with minutia information having a similarity value equal to or greater than a preset reference value may be extracted from the DB 101 and the copyright information may be extracted from the extracted book information and transmitted to the sharing server 400.
